1 General Information VCSBC4012 Single Board Camera The VCSBC4012 has been designed for high resolution image processing with a very small form factor. The VCSBC4012 is the ideal compromise between high performance and low system costs, and thus expecially suited for high volume OEM applications. This makes it viable to use a smart camera in even more products than before.
SDRAM memory, which has been increased to 64MB, due to the large camera image. Unlike most other Vision Component Smart Cameras, the VCSBC4012 does not have a direct video output. However if monitoring of the camera image is required, this can be done by downloading via “Image Transfer”...

VCSBC4012.pdf – VCSBC4012 Single Board Smart Camera Operating Manual 6.2 Ethernet Communication The default camera IP address is 192.168.0.65 – as with all Ethernet cameras from VC. The IP address can be changed to a different loading a #IP file into camera memory.
Resetting the Camera with help of the VCnet Recovery Tool A new tool – the “Vcnet Recovery Tool” is provided for resetting the IP address of the VCSBC4012 and VC4012 cameras. Vcnet Recovery is supported from camera OS VCRT 5.21.
VCSBC4012.pdf – VCSBC4012 Single Board Smart Camera Operating Manual 6.5 Special VCRT functions for programming VCSBC4012 cameras This sections explains the specifics of programming VCSBC4012 cameras. 6.5.1 Trigger Functions Apart form the inverse TTL logic (see section 4.2.3) and the different status register shown below, the trigger works like with the VC4XXX cameras.
TRIGOUT_POS(); The trigger macros are also described in our programming tutorial. The use of TRIGOUT_USR(), SET_TRIGOUT() and RES_TRIGOUT() is limited on the VCSBC4012 camera! Use only with slow applications and long shutter times (the sensor needs several milliseconds to execute the signal change).
